BIDU-SW Once Slips ~4% Amid Reports of CN Halting Autonomous Driving Permit Issuance

BIDU-SW (09888.HK) opened up 1.3% this morning (29th), but its momentum started diminishing at around 11:30 am. It once sank by 3.9% to a bottom of HKD118.5. It last traded at HKD120.6, down 2.2%, with a turnover of HKD983 million.

According to a Bloomberg report, China has suspended the issuance of new high-level autonomous driving permits after BIDU-SW's Apollo Go Robotaxis experienced a large-scale malfunction in Wuhan last month. It remains unclear how long this suspension will last.
